I nmil InIt a It IN it I,Lhir t <br /> April 9, 2018 �� � <br /> Michael Cunningham OPR © 111 <br /> Colorado Division of Reclamation, Mining, and Safety AVftN <br /> 1313 Sherman Street, Rm 215 ON <br /> Denver, CO 80203 <br /> RE: Alma Placer Mine; DRMS File No. M-1985-029; Amendment No. 6; Adequacy <br /> Review No. 1 <br /> On March 5, 2018, High Mountain Mining Co, LLC received the Division's adequacy <br /> review of AM-06 of the Alma Placer Mine DRMS permit. The following is an item by item <br /> response to each of the Division's concerns. <br /> 1. As required by Rule 1.6.S (2),please submit a copy of the public notice which was published <br /> in a newspaper of local circulation. Proof of publication may consist of either a copy of the <br /> last newspaper publication, to include the dates published, or a certified or notarized <br /> statement from the paper. <br /> Please see the attached copy of the public notice as well as proof of publication. <br /> 2. As required by Rule 1.6.2(1)(g),please submit proof the above referenced public notice was <br /> circulated to all owners of record of surface lands, and easement holders that are on the <br /> affected land and within 200 feet of the boundary of all affected lands. Proof of notice maybe <br /> return receipts of a Certified Mailing or by proof ofpersonal service. <br /> Please see the attached proof of public notice submittal to the owners of surface lands, <br /> easements, and structures within 200 feet of the permit area. <br /> 3. The Division received comments from the Colorado Historical Society and the Division of <br /> Water Resources. The letters have been attached for your review. Please address the <br /> comments noted in the letters, and make any changes in the application as necessary. <br /> The attached letters were reviewed. The Division of Water Resources comments are <br /> addressed under the appropriate adequacy items in this letter. The Office of Archaeology <br /> and Historic Preservation of the Colorado Historical Society does not require any additional <br /> action pending the discovery of human remains; however, it is not expected that human <br /> remains will be found in the area. <br /> 6.4.3 Exhibit C—Pre-mining and Mining Plan Maps of Affected Lands <br />
